Arabian ouds are Typically greater than their Turkish and Persian counterparts, instrument generating a fuller, deeper sound, whereas the seem of your Turkish oud is more taut and shrill, not the very least as the Turkish oud is frequently (and partly) tuned just one total move better in comparison rap music to the Arabian.[fifty four] Turkish ouds are usually a lot more lightly constructed than Arabian having an unfinished sound board, lessen string motion and with string programs placed nearer jointly.

For the rear from the boat Is that this guy, and what he’s the rudder guy employing an oar to tutorial the barge in the ideal direction. Should you examine almost every other cylinder seal graphic from then, or in reality any impression of those or related barges (I’ve witnessed some from Byzantine manuscripts done 3,000 decades later!), you’ll see in essence exactly the same format: punter in entrance, enclosed location or significant passenger in the middle, rudder gentleman on the back again, in the same posture. The reed boats utilized by Marsh Arabs in southern Iraq currently use exactly the same setup. Sure scholars, eager to find a Substantially earlier date for the primary lute devices than what we have (the Akkadian period, c. 2334-2150 BCE) have regretably seized around the lute interpretation Regardless of how uncomplicated it is to indicate if not. Even though the important entry of the short lute was in western Europe, bringing about several different lute models, the shorter lute entered Europe during the East also; as early because the sixth century, the Bulgars brought the shorter-necked range of the instrument identified as Komuz on the Balkans.
